Rising electricity use is the best indicator of China's economic improvement. Power use by manufacturing, mining and construction companies climbed to its highest level since 2009 during July, rebounding from a two-year low in February. Increased use of electricity, along with reports showing better-than-expected growth in factory output, exports and imports, hints at Chinese recovery.
